Elasticsearch 執行架構詳解

2021-10-09 16:23:45 字數 395 閱讀 7337

檔案系統 hdfs,資料庫 hbase,訊息佇列 kafka,協調服務 zookeeper,接下來要讓大資料儲存的生態圈變得更完整,不得不提的就是搜尋引擎了,雖然說 elasticsearch 是以搜尋聞名的,但是說到底它還是個資料庫,它底層的儲存特性使它擁有了毫秒級的全文檢索響應能力,很好地補充了大資料在文字檢索這塊的處理能力。 es 的創始人 shay banon 很好地詮釋了偉大的專案是來自於生活的,據說當初 es 開發的最初目的是為了給他老婆做乙個食譜搜尋的功能,接下來我們就來看看這個「食譜搜尋引擎」在面試官那裡能問出些什麼花樣。

本篇面試內容劃重點:架構、讀寫、調優。

ElasticSearch安裝及執行的坑

寫文章 sam dragon 發表於cnblogs訂閱 158 2.用 tar zxvf 解壓包 3.增加乙個elk使用者,elasticsearch7不可用root使用者執行 4.新建使用者必須要用 chown r 使用者名稱 資料夾 進行許可權分配 1 max file descriptors ...

elasticsearch 執行分布式檢索 九

乙個 crud 操作只對單個文件進行處理,文件的唯一性由 index,type,和 routing values 通常預設是該文件的 id 的組合來確定。這表示我們確切的知道集群中哪個分片含有此文件。但是找到所有的匹配文件僅僅完成事情的一半。在 search 介面返回乙個 page 結果之前,多分片...

elasticsearch配置詳解

elasticsearch的config資料夾裡面有兩個配置檔案 elasticsearch.yml和logging.yml,第乙個是es的基本配置檔案,第二個是日誌配置檔案,es也是使用log4j來記錄日誌的,所以logging.yml裡的設定按普通log4j配置檔案來設定就行了。下面主要講解下e...